Get started2 Dawley Court is a two-bedroom semi-detached house in Arnold, Nottingham, Nottingham (NG5 7HY). It has a recorded floor area of 53 m² (around 570 sq ft), construction records dating it to 1967-1975 and council tax band B. Tenure is freehold. At 53 m² this is the 2nd smallest of 6 units on EPC record in the building, where floor areas span 51–62 m². The building's EPC ratings span D to C, with this unit at the top. The latest certificate (August 2024) shows a C (score 77), near the top of the C band. When first surveyed in May 2011 the rating was D, the property has climbed 1 band since. Between certificates, wall efficiency went from Poor to Average, roof efficiency went from Average to Very Good and lighting went from Very Poor to Very Good.
Held since January 2008 — that's 18 years off the open market, well above the local norm. That sale landed at the peak of the pre-credit-crunch market, which is a useful reference point when interpreting the price. Today's modelled estimate of £132,000 sits 50% above the 2008 sale of £88,000.
